Latest Patents

David Cheng-Hsiung Chen holds a patent for a bar circuit designed for integrated circuits. The patent, titled "Bar Circuit for an Integrated Circuit," provides a solution to minimize cross talk and eddy current. The invention comprises a semiconductor substrate with a first conductivity type, a strip of first well with a second conductivity type, and a strip of second well also with the second conductivity type. The strategic placement of these components forms a junction barrier that effectively reduces unwanted electrical interference.
